TURN-208: Gatevale turnstile counters at the Merrow Field pilot double-count when a rotation reverses mid-cycle. Attendance totals drift roughly 2% high per event. The debounce window fix is implemented, reviewed by Ilsa, and soak-tested across two simulated match days without drift. Ready for your cut; the candidate build is identified below.

trace token, tagag-tafog: htk6_5ed18c

Each plugin receives an isolated token bucket; bursts above the sustained rate are absorbed up to the bucket depth, after which requests receive a retryable backpressure response. Plan your polling and batch sizes against these limits rather than hammering retries — repeated violations trigger a temporary penalty window that lengthens with each offense. We revisit these figures quarterly based on aggregate load. The current per-plugin tuning constants are listed below.

tuning constants:
QUOTAS = {
    "druwyn": 5,
    "holix": 5,
    "zorath": 5,
    "holwyn": 10,
}

Re: Retirement of the Stonebriar product line

Stonebriar sales have declined for five consecutive quarters and support costs now exceed contribution margin. The retirement plan is staged: new orders close end of Q2, existing contracts honoured through their terms, and spares stocked for twenty-four months. Sales leads should steer prospects toward the Ashgrove range; migration incentives are already approved. Customer comms are drafted and awaiting legal sign-off. The forward strategy behind this decision is set out in the note below.

confidential, yafog-hagug: Gross margin on Druix came in at 10 percent against a plan of 15 percent. Only 5 of the 80 pilot accounts renewed Druix, so a churn review is set for October 1.

## Formula sandbox tuning

User-supplied formulas in Gridmoor execute inside a restricted interpreter with hard ceilings on time, memory, and call depth. Reviewers should confirm any change to these ceilings is justified in the PR description, since raising them widens the abuse surface. Defaults were chosen from production traces. The current limits are as follows.

limits module of tafog-fawip:
WEIGHTS = {
    "julix": 57,
    "lamys": 992,
    "kasvan": 209,
    "quenok": 750,
    "alddor": 259,
    "oliath": 1009,
    "wenix": 815,
}